Seared Salmon Fillet with Garlic Mashed Potatoes and Steamed Asparagus
Pan-seared salmon fillet served with creamy garlic-infused mashed potatoes and crisp steamed asparagus, finished with a squeeze of bright lemon.
INGREDIENTS
7 oz Salmon Fillet
350g Yukon Gold Potatoes
150g Asparagus
1.5 tbsp Ghee
0.5 tbsp Olive Oil
3 cloves Garlic
PREPARATION
Peel and cube the potatoes, then boil in salted water until tender.
Trim the woody ends off the asparagus and steam for 4-5 minutes until tender-crisp.
Pat the salmon fillet dry with a paper towel and season both sides with salt and pepper.
Heat ol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and sear the salmon for 4 minutes skin-side down.
Flip the salmon and cook for another 3-4 minutes until the center is just opaque.
Drain the potatoes and mash them with ghee and minced garlic until smooth and fluffy.
Plate the salmon alongside the mashed potatoes and asparagus, garnishing with a fresh lemon wedge.
